Understanding Ultrasonic Cleaners
Ultrasonic cleaners use high-frequency sound waves to create microscopic bubbles in a cleaning solution. These bubbles implode upon contact with surfaces, causing dirt, grime, and other contaminants to be dislodged efficiently. Because of their effectiveness, ultrasonic cleaners are widely used in various industries, including jewelry, automotive, and even dental practices.

Material Suitability
Understanding the materials used in your San Martin watch is crucial for determining ultrasonic cleaner compatibility:
- Stainless Steel: Most San Martin watches feature stainless steel casings, which are generally safe for ultrasonic cleaning.
- Sapphire Crystals: These durable crystals can withstand ultrasonic cleaning without scratching or damage.
- Leather Straps: Ultrasonic cleaning is not advisable for leather straps, as they can become damaged or degraded in the process.
- Coatings: Certain models may feature coatings or finishes that could be sensitive to ultrasonic cleaning solutions.

Risks Associated with Ultrasonic Cleaning
While ultrasonic cleaners offer numerous benefits, certain risks must be considered, especially concerning expensive watches like those made by San Martin:
- Water Resistance: If your San Martin watch is not properly sealed or has damaged gaskets, the ultrasonic cleaner could introduce moisture to delicate components, causing damage.
- Loose Parts: If any parts of your watch are loose, the ultrasonic cleaning process could exacerbate the situation, potentially causing components to dislodge and leading to costly repairs.
- Incompatible Materials: As previously mentioned, some materials and coatings may react negatively to ultrasonic cleaning solutions, leading to discoloration or damage.
How to Safely Clean Your San Martin Watch with an Ultrasonic Cleaner
If you decide to use an ultrasonic cleaner on your San Martin watch, following these guidelines will help minimize risks and ensure effective cleaning:
Preparation
- Check for Damage: Inspect your watch for any signs of wear, loose components, or damage before proceeding.
- Remove Leather Straps: Detach leather or sensitive straps to prevent damage during the cleaning process.
- Seal Check: Ensure that your watch’s seals are intact and functioning correctly to maintain water resistance.
Using the Ultrasonic Cleaner
- Setup the Cleaner: Fill the ultrasonic cleaner tank with a suitable cleaning solution. It’s advisable to use one designed specifically for watches or jewelry.
- Adjust Settings: Most ultrasonic cleaners have customizable settings. For watches, use a mild setting to avoid excessive agitation.
- Cleaning Time: Place the watch in the cleaner for a short duration, usually between 2-5 minutes, depending on the condition of your watch. Over-cleaning can lead to unintended wear.
Post-Cleaning Care
- Rinse: After cleaning, rinse your watch gently with fresh water to remove any cleaning solution residue.
- Dry Thoroughly: Use a soft cloth to dry your watch completely, ensuring no moisture remains.
- Check Functionality: After cleaning, check that the watch is functioning correctly before wearing it again.

Hand Cleaning
Hand cleaning can be a reliable and safer alternative, especially for more delicate watches. Here’s how to do it:
- Gather Materials: You’ll need soft microfiber cloths, a soft brush (like a toothbrush), and a gentle soap solution.
- Wipe the Case: Use a damp cloth to wipe the watch case, removing superficial dirt and grime.
- Brush the Links: For bracelets, use the soft brush to gently scrub between the links, where dirt often accumulates.
- Rinse and Dry: Lightly rinse the watch under running water and gently dry it with a soft cloth.
